The 2025 Spring Classics season kicked off with significant races in Flanders, featuring both men's and women's categories. Early competitions like Omloop Het Nieuwsblad highlighted the performance of the men's Classics superteam Visma-Lease a Bike, which was noted to be underwhelming compared to the previous years. The events have set the stage for anticipation leading up to major prizes like the Tour of Flanders and Paris-Roubaix. Insights from riders like Jasper Philipsen point to changes in team dynamics and competitive aggressiveness as key talking points.
"It's also clear that UAE and Visma were not as aggressive as we've seen in the last year. Of course, they were there, but not better than the others," Philipsen pointed out.
